SAP ABAP vs SAP BASIS: Which Path Is Right for You?
SAP ABAP and BASIS are confused by many new individuals in the SAP community. They both are important parts of how SAP functions, but they accomplish very different tasks, require different skills, and result in different careers.
In case you are considering enrolling in SAP ABAP Training in Vijayawada or are a novel person to SAP, it is essential to know that there are key differences between the two approaches ABAP and BASIS. This page informs you of the difference in the two in terms of their jobs, duties, career ways and training requirements so that you make an informed decision.
Development vs. Administration: The Core Distinction
On the theoretical level, the SAP ABAP and SAP BASIS are technical jobs that have specific functions:
- The primary objective of SAP ABAP is to write the business logic having the SAP environment, which entails writing apps, reports, enhancements as well as developing distinct workflows.
- SAP BASIS can keep in tune with system administration through upgrades and patches as well as tuning of the infrastructure; ensuring that SAP applications are well functioning, secure and technical.
ABAP is your thing when you enjoy developing programs, writing, then executing logic, and business problems to code. In case you are interested in system architecture, performance management, and IT infrastructure, the more appropriate option is the BASIS.
Skill Set Requirements: Creative Logic vs. Technical Precision
Skill Area | SAP ABAP | SAP BASIS |
Focus | Application Development | System Management |
Core Skills | Programming (ABAP, OO-ABAP), debugging, database access | Server configuration, database administration, system tuning |
Tools | SE38, SE80, ALV, Smart Forms | OS-level tools, SAP Solution Manager, SAP GUI, and HANA Studio |
Collaboration | Develops business logic in conjunction with functional teams. | Works with technical teams to maintain system stability and performance |
Complexity | Logical, modular thinking for coding tasks | Deep system knowledge (OS, DB, SAP architecture) for technical support |
Your mode of work and thinking will determine greatly which of these two areas either or both you focus on. You should go with ABAP if you love to do it on a blank paper and you are thorough. BASIS is most applicable to individuals with good skills at sustaining business, systems management and holistic approach to performance.
Career Path & Growth: Specialist vs. Architect
Even both of them offer advancement chances:
- ABAP can create such positions as Technical Architect, SAP Developer Lead, or even S/ 4HANA Conversion Specialist. In cases with UI5 and Fiori gaining popularity, developers of ABAP are also moving into front-end development.
- SAP BASIS professionals are likely to make a step up and become SAP Security Consultant, Cloud Administrator, or SAP Infrastructure Architect.
Nowadays, cloud-first economy demands the new level of competence of the BASIS skills with SAP HANA, Azure, AWS, and GCP. The expertise of the ABAP specialists in the field should include CDS views, high-performance development of the HANA systems, and the modern APIs.
Real-World Application: Development vs. Operational Responsibility
The day-to-day responsibilities between ABAP and BASIS differ significantly:
Criteria | SAP ABAP | SAP BASIS |
Development | Yes – programs, reports, enhancements | No |
Infrastructure | No | Yes – hardware, DB, OS |
Upgrades & Patch Management | Minimal involvement | Core responsibility |
System Downtime Handling | Not responsible | Fully responsible |
Transport Management | Occasionally interacts | Actively manages transport layers |
Client Copy, System Refresh | Not applicable | Daily tasks |
Therefore, as the developers of ABAP work on the creation of functionality, BASIS keeps the functionality operating in a secure and optimized environment. They are two sides of a coin, they are mutually dependent, but in two totally different areas of focus.
Learning Curve & Training Focus
SAP ABAP:
- The learning requirements include object-oriented concepts, mastering a proprietary language (ABAP) and SAP database objects and learning report development.
- A well-designed SAP ABAP training in Vijayawada will involve practice coding, debugging, enhancement, Smart Forms and involvement in live projects.
Suitable to individuals with a computer program/engineering background.
SAP BASIS:
- Assumes a basic knowledge of operating systems (Unix/Linux/Windows), database (Oracle, HANA, SQL Server) and the system architecture.
- Comprehensive BASIS training encompasses installation, configuration, transport management, user administration, and performance optimization.
Both careers are practical careers that need practice with real-life SAP landscapes. Nevertheless, SAP ABAP learning curve is more of a development oriented whereas SAP BASIS tends more towards infrastructure and logic with system.
Demand in the Job Market
Both of these skills are required constantly (particularly with more companies moving to SAP S/4HANA). SAP ABAP developers are also expecting to be integrated with Fiori/UI5, upgrade legacy programming, and optimize to run on HANA. Certified specialists in SAP BASIS are necessary to support hybrid systems, cloud-bound migrations, and system maintenance. BASIS is more in demand in the enterprise IT and cloud support functions, but the ABAP area has more offshore and project-based areas.
Training Options in Vijayawada
In Vijayawada, SAP ABAP training is a good place to start as one considers a career in SAP. Many training centers in Vijayawada offer in-person and online SAP ABAP training to support the different learning requirements.
This fact is that Version IT is the only institution close internationally that provides full training programs in ABAP with hands-on lab support and actual real time case studies. It is ideal for those who wish to acquire a solid fence in ABAP and prepare to pass certification examinations or land employment.
Final Thoughts
Your career goals, interests, and strengths will determine whether you choose SAP ABAP or BASIS. BASIS is suitable for those who are curious to learn the systems behind the machines which run SAP, whereas ABAP suits those who are more curious about development and logical problem solving.
Both of these roles provide a long-term career development and are critical to SAP projects, especially since SAP is making its way to a cloud and a HANA-based system.
If you are willing to invest in your career, enrolling in an elite SAP ABAP Training facility in Vijayawada can provide the technical richness and project experience you require to shine in the employment market. Developing your SAP expertise today will be the basis of your success in the future once you decide whether to train at home or turn to the SAP ABAP Training on-site or online in Vijayawada.